5 Benefits of Outdoor Advertising

  • Written by: Tanya Mayer


Nowadays, most of us spend more time away from home than we do cooped up in our comfortable nest. The daily hustle and bustle, our jobs and other obligations have us hit the streets early in the morning, and come back late in the evening, and while we are outdoors, we might not even realize it but we come across thousands of advertisements every day. Advertising outdoors is effective for this reason: people spend a lot of time going about their business and therefore, these advertisements are in front of them every day. But there is even more to the benefits of outdoor advertising. Here are some of them:

Outdoor advertising is more than just billboards

While the words “outdoor advertising” might make you think of billboards first, there is actually so much more to it, which makes it a flexible option available for any business of any size. Think phone booths, shopping malls, benches, as well as different types of mobile advertising such as buses or taxis or even your own vehicle in a car wrap. It is more than obvious, thus, that it can fit anyone’s budget.

It has amazing reach

Outdoor advertising has a wide reach in more than one way. First of all, billboards and other signs might be the only way to reach some people who either don’t use technology that much or don’t have time to consume print media but might still be interested in your products or services. Therefore, it is advised that companies look beyond online advertising and also consider refreshing their business with print since it is evident how these traditional methods are still as effective as ever. On the other hand, the aforementioned mobile advertising methods are even more incredible in spreading the word about your business. Used mostly for non-location specific offers, one cleverly-placed ad on a city bus will be seen by everyone coming into contact with the route of the bus for a few weeks. It’s a great way to cover a large area.

It has a high impact

Beside high reach, outdoor advertising also has a high impact. While at home, people can just change channels on their TV or turn it off when commercials come on; but when a billboard is placed in front of them on the road, they don’t have the option to turn it off. People walking the streets are also aware of their surroundings, including the ads around them. Similarly, advertisements placed on public transport such as inside buses or metros will also see an incredible amount of attention, as large numbers of people will have nothing better to do while commuting than to look at the ads around them. In fact, research has shown several times that the majority of people prefer buses with ads to buses without advertisement.

It has a high ROI

While at first glance, this type of advertising might look very expensive compared to online advertising, when you take into account the numbers, it soon becomes clear that outdoor advertising is worth the investment. Outdoor advertising has an outstandingly high ROI – research says that for some industries such as the travel industry, the ROI for every dollar spent could be as high as $3.55! This is thanks to the low CPM (cost per thousand impressions) of outdoor advertising. This is why your best bet is always going for high-traffic areas when placing outdoor advertisements.

It reinforces brand awareness

Your goal should always be building your brand and making sure people can recognize it as soon as they see it. For that, you have to get your brand across to them several times through various media. This is why outdoor advertising works best in combination with other media. While it can serve well in itself thanks to immediately building brand awareness, using it to enhance brand awareness will engrave your message into your audience’s mind.

 

If you still don’t use outdoor advertising for your business, you are missing out on a large potential. Regardless of your budget, you can leverage some sort of outdoor advertising and reach a new level of brand awareness.

How Real-time Data Services Cater to Your Business Needs

  • Written by: News Company

Leading and managing a business is a complex feat. Countless internal and external factors can influence the performance of your business. Whether it’s a new wave of technology, a shift in global market trends, rising competitors, or a financial crisis – most of these elements are often out of your control.

However, even when these factors might be beyond your leadership, your organization can still control how it reacts to them. And, this is where you need effective business tools like real-time data services and cloud-based solutions.



With zero delays, data is delivered to you in seconds to help your business draw insights and apt solutions. Here’s how real-time data can empower your company and take it to new heights.


  1. Helps Businesses Adopt a Proactive Approach

Enterprises typically take on a reactive approach when it comes to issues related to project deadlines, inventory management, and budgeting. This was largely due to a lack of accessibility of data that could be used to predict future strategies and customer behaviour. Now, technology offers businesses the power to implement predictive strategies. By using analytics, data mining, and computer-learning algorithms, it’s become easier to identify patterns that were previously missing in traditional data-gathering tools.

Instead of wasting time and resources on gathering data and making sense of it, real-time data services merge all the information in a coherent manner. Businesses can then easily connect the dots and use predictive analytics to enact pro-active solutions.

It also gives managers and leaders enough time to list down potential issues and create well-planned contingency plans. This readily reduces downtime and helps a business stay on top of their game.


  1. Enhances Management Efficiency

Using Big Data solutions and IoT services automatically empower your business with better management strategies. For example, IoT sensor infrastructure can readily help managers achieve workspace optimization.

Sensors keep the managers updated with when, how, and at what time the workspace is being used. Information on when the traffic in the office is at its highest and how much more space is needed can help managers efficiently devise solutions. Using IoT for building management is also a great way to speed up work, streamline business processes, and reduce downtime.


  1. Improves In-House Collaboration

With low levels of productivity and employee turnover expenses, your business can tremendously suffer. In order to eliminate these issues, companies must prioritize on empowering the workforce. This is essentially achieved by listening to their feedback, including them in key decisions, and offering the right workplace tools to improve efficiency. Collaboration is the key to successful teamwork. A workforce that is disengaged or unclear about its objectives can cost companies billions of dollars.

The application of big data analytics is what makes this possible. When your business starts using an information-centric, data-driven platform that is widely accessible in real-time to all the team members, the collaboration will automatically improve. The shared accessibility of real-time data shifts the power of balance in an organization. From the senior managers all the way down to the employees, everyone is aware of the objectives and strategies. The outcome? Improved efficiency through pro-active strategies and of course, a reduction in workplace redundancy.


  1. Live Interaction with Site Visitors

Real-time data tools allow you to view your site in live mode. You’ll know exactly who is visiting the site, where they’re from, and what paths they’ll be taking. This is a great opportunity to use the database to tag your customers and interact with them.

Many real-time tools also allow you to launch live-chat sessions with customers who are busy browsing your products/services. It shows you if a specific visitor is clicking on several links to look for something. You can then message and help them out with their options. It’s a wonderful opportunity to offer your customers a valuable service.

There’s nothing real-time data tools can’t achieve. It can empower your business with unimaginable possibilities and readily enhance efficiency.
